Page 1 of 1

[Axe] Utilitaires

Unread postPosted: 05 Mar 2018, 12:20
by Ti64CLi++
Voilà plusieurs utilitaires, pas du tout optimisé, je précise.
  • Un utilitaire de copie, copie un programme vers un autre. Nécessite INPUTAXE.8xp
    COPYSRC.8xp
  • Un utilitaire très pratique si vous voulez apprendre la programmation hexa. Convertis un programme en sa valeur hexa. Nécessite INPUTAXE.8xp
    Ne pas essayer avec un programme non assembleur
    TOHEXSRC.8xv
  • Un petit utilitaire qui affiche le code d'un programme ou d'une appvar. Nécessite INPUTAXE.8xp et MENUAXE.8xp
    AXECHEAT.8xv
  • Une librairie de fonction Input. Contient deux fonctions :
    • Une fonction Input(X,Y,Limit,Ptr) qui attend une entrée, avec un maximum de Limit caractères, et retournera la chaine de caractère dans Ptr
    • Une fonction InputHex(X,Y,Bytes,Ptr) qui attend une entrée, contenant seulement les caractères hexadécimaux donc 0123456789ABCDEF, avec un certain nombre de Bytes, et retournera la chaine de caractère dans Ptr
    INPUTAXE.8xv
  • Une librairie de fonction Menu. Contient une fonction :
    • Une fonction Menu(Title,Args, N), avec un maximum de 7 arguments, N étant le nombre d'arguments donnés à la fonction. Les arguments doivent être une liste de chaine de caractère terminée par 0. Ex : Menu("Mon menu","Option1"[00]"Option2"[00]"Quitter"[00],3)
    MENUAXE.8xv

Si vous voyez des bugs, prévenez moi, si vous pensez qu'il manque une fonction, dites le moi.

Ti64CLi++